基于端口的虚拟主机测试方法是什么

基于端口的虚拟主机测试方法是通过不同的TCP端口号来区分不同的站点内容,因此用户在浏览不同的虚拟站点时需要同时指定端口号才能访问。

什么是虚拟主机?

虚拟主机(Virtual Host)是一种托管服务,它允许多个用户共享同一个物理服务器上的资源,虚拟主机通过将一个服务器划分为多个独立的虚拟服务器来实现这一目标,每个虚拟服务器都可以拥有自己的独立域名和IP地址,以及操作系统、应用程序和服务,这样,用户可以根据自己的需求选择合适的虚拟主机,而无需购买和维护自己的服务器。

基于端口的虚拟主机测试方法是什么?

基于端口的虚拟主机测试方法主要针对服务器上的某个特定端口进行测试,以检查该端口是否正常工作,这种方法可以帮助我们发现服务器上可能存在的端口冲突、端口未开放等问题,以下是基于端口的虚拟主机测试方法的步骤:

基于端口的虚拟主机测试方法是什么

1、确定要测试的端口号,通常,我们会使用一些常见的端口号,如80(HTTP)、443(HTTPS)、22(SSH)等,还可以使用一些特殊的端口号,如1024-65535之间的任意整数。

2、在本地计算机上打开网络监控工具,有许多网络监控工具可供选择,如Windows自带的“netstat”命令、第三方工具Wireshark等,这些工具可以帮助我们实时查看网络连接和传输数据。

3、尝试在服务器上建立到目标端口的连接,可以使用telnet命令或其他网络工具来实现这一目的,在命令行中输入以下命令:

telnet 目标服务器IP地址 目标端口号

如果连接成功,说明目标端口是开放的;如果连接失败,可能是由于防火墙限制、端口未开放等原因导致的。

4、检查服务器上的应用程序或服务是否监听指定的端口,这可以通过查看应用程序的配置文件、日志文件等来实现,如果应用程序正在监听指定的端口,那么我们可以认为该端口是正常的。

如何解决基于端口的虚拟主机测试方法中发现的问题?

根据基于端口的虚拟主机测试方法发现的问题,我们可以采取以下措施进行解决:

基于端口的虚拟主机测试方法是什么

1、如果发现端口未开放,需要联系服务器提供商或管理员,要求开放相应的端口,还需要检查服务器的防火墙设置,确保没有误封相关端口。

2、如果发现端口冲突,需要修改其中一个应用程序或服务的配置文件,将其绑定到另一个未被占用的端口上,然后重新启动应用程序或服务,使更改生效。

3、如果发现其他问题,如网络连接不稳定、应用程序崩溃等,需要根据具体情况进行分析和排查,这可能涉及到网络设备、硬件故障、软件错误等多个方面,在解决问题时,可以参考相关的技术文档、论坛讨论等资源。

相关问题与解答

1、如何查看服务器上的开放端口?

答:可以使用Windows自带的“netstat”命令(在命令提示符中输入“netstat -a”)或第三方工具(如Wireshark)来查看服务器上的开放端口,这些工具可以帮助我们实时查看网络连接和传输数据。

2、如何防止端口冲突?

基于端口的虚拟主机测试方法是什么

答:为了防止端口冲突,可以在分配端口号时遵循一定的规则,可以将常用的服务(如HTTP、HTTPS、FTP等)分配较短的端口号(如80、443、21等),而将不太常用的服务分配较长的端口号(如1024-65535之间的任意整数),还可以使用防火墙等安全工具来限制不必要的端口访问。

3、如何测试虚拟主机的速度?

答:可以使用ping命令或类似的工具来测试虚拟主机的速度,在命令行中输入以下命令:

ping 目标虚拟主机IP地址

这将显示从本地计算机到目标虚拟主机的往返时间(RTT),通过多次执行此命令并计算平均值,可以得到相对准确的延迟时间,可以根据延迟时间判断虚拟主机的速度是否满足需求。

原创文章,作者:酷盾叔,如若转载,请注明出处:https://www.kdun.com/ask/140603.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
酷盾叔订阅
上一篇 2024-01-08 01:31
下一篇 2024-01-08 01:33

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入